House clouds, or nebulae as they’re extra correctly recognized are huge nurseries the place stars are born from swirling collections of gasoline and dirt scattered all through a galaxy. These aren’t fluffy white clouds like those we see within the sky, they’re monumental areas stretching gentle years throughout, crammed with hydrogen, helium, and hint quantities of heavier components left over from earlier generations of stars. Some glow brilliantly with vibrant colors as close by stars illuminate them, whereas others seem as darkish silhouettes blocking the sunshine of stars behind them. Inside these clouds, gravity slowly pulls matter collectively over hundreds of thousands of years, creating dense pockets that finally collapse to kind new stars and planetary programs.

Utilizing one of many world’s strongest radio telescopes, researchers from MIT have found greater than 100 totally different molecules swirling round in a single cloud of gasoline in house. To place that in perspective, that is extra chemical variety than we have ever present in some other cloud on the market within the universe. The cloud in query has the quite unglamorous title of the Taurus Molecular Cloud-1, or TMC-1 should you’re feeling lazy. It is a chilly area of house the place stars like our Solar are born, and it seems to be an absolute chemical playground. The staff spent over 1,400 hours pointing the Inexperienced Financial institution Telescope in West Virginia at this cloud, accumulating information that the majority of us could not make head nor tail of, however which tells chemists precisely what’s floating round up there.

What’s significantly fascinating is what they discovered. Most of those molecules are hydrocarbons, that are primarily simply carbon and hydrogen connnected in varied totally different preparations, together with nitrogen wealthy compounds. Apparently, there aren’t many oxygen containing molecules, which is sort of totally different from what we see round stars which are already forming.

Maybe most enjoyable is the detection of 10 fragrant molecules. These are ring formed carbon buildings that sound fancy however are literally in every single place on Earth. They’re in espresso, vanilla, and even in your DNA. Discovering them in a stellar nursery suggests these basic constructing blocks of advanced chemistry had been current proper from the beginning.

However this is the place it will get actually intelligent. Again in 2021, this identical dataset helped remedy a thriller that had been bugging scientists because the Nineteen Eighties. They lastly recognized particular person PAH molecules in house for the primary time. PAHs, or polycyclic fragrant hydrocarbons are advanced carbon molecules that scientists had suspected had been on the market however could not show. Now they’ve discovered a great deal of them, displaying there is a large reservoir of reactive natural carbon current even earlier than stars and planets correctly kind.

What makes this analysis significantly sensible is that the staff hasn’t simply saved all this information to themselves. They’ve made your entire dataset publicly obtainable so different scientists can dive in and doubtlessly make their very own discoveries.

This molecular census provides us a benchmark for understanding what chemical situations existed earlier than our personal Photo voltaic System fashioned. It is primarily a snapshot of the elements checklist that was obtainable when Earth was only a twinkle within the universe’s eye, and it’d simply assist us perceive how life itself acquired began.
